NettetBILLY HALOP TRIBUTE-FOREVER SOAPY. William "Billy" Halop (February 11, 1920 – November 9, 1976) was an American actor born in NYC. He came from a theatrical family: his mother was a dancer, and his sister Florence was a child actress, who later worked on radio and in television. Halop was born to Benjamin Cohen Halop and Lucille Elizabeth Halop on February 11, 1920. Halop came from a theatrical family; his mother was a dancer, and his sister, Florence Halop, was an actress who worked on radio and in television. Additionally, he had a brother named Joel.
